It was my first time in a ski resort and to this part of the world, Val Thorens. Located in the Tarentaise Valley, Savoie, French Alps, it is the highest ski resort in Europe, at a 2300 metre altitude. We arrived in the evening, past sunset having travelled on the train from Paris to Mutiers train station where the hotel shuttle bus picked us up.

The Koh-I Nor takes its name from the 105,6 carat diamond on the crown of the British royal and in Persian it means ”Mountain of light”. Perched on a hill top has an impressive diamond shaped glass exterior and you enter a glass lift to ascend into the reception area where the lovely staff were there to welcome us. Spa

The spa is stunning, flooded in natural light and and with all the bells and whistles sooth the skin relax the muscles and detox the body – two pools, fitness center, sauna, hammam, jacuzzi, experience showers, salt wall, and ice fountain. There are four treatment rooms for massages and beauty therapies. I treated myself to a head and shoulder massage, a necessity for someone who works a lot at a computer!

Food

There are 3 restaurants, the gourmet “Le Diamant Noir” for fine dining; the newest addition Le Cave, headed by Michelin starred chef Eric Samson, presenting local specialties, made of carefully selected regional products; and L’Atelier d’Eric, an international restaurant reveals that offers a set menu of five dishes and an exceptional buffet breakfast. Champagne is an option at breakfast should you want a bit of Dutch courage before hitting the slopes!

Getting there:
Moutiers Train Station is 37 km from the property and Chambéry Airport is 112 km away.
